The Farelab ticket-pricing experiment service rejected last night's config push with a signature mismatch, so the new fare variants never went live and all venues fell back to baseline pricing. Root cause: the config was signed with the retired staging key after last week's rotation. No customer-facing pricing errors occurred. Support should tell experimenters to re-sign configs with the current key and resubmit; pushes verified against it deploy normally. The active verification key is below.

release key, bahof-hafog: bky3_ztf

## Changelog — Ticktrace 1.9

### Renamed: DRIFT_API_TOKEN
During the cron drift investigation we found plugins confusing this variable with the metrics token, so it has been renamed to indicate it authorizes drift-report uploads specifically. Plugin authors must read the new name from 1.9 onward; the old name is ignored without warning. Sample env files in the SDK are updated. In your deployment env file, the drift-report upload secret is set on the next line.

env line for fawef-taguf: VAULT_KEY13=a9695905a9a90

## Deployment

Welcome aboard. The Quillpress rendering service is deployed as a single container behind the Marrowgate load balancer, with two replicas per region. Template compilation is cached in-process, so cold starts are slow for roughly the first minute; do not alarm on latency during rollout. Always deploy to the shadow environment first and compare render timings before promoting. Performance tuning is controlled entirely through the configuration block that follows below.

deployment values, tafog-kagap:
wenath:
  pin: 4244
  metrics_host: metrics.wenath.lumicsys.internal
  tenant: istix
  seal: seal_10585894